Cassandra Neyenesch Reads "Enough for Now"

March 29, 2026·35 min
Episode Description from the Publisher

Cassandra Neyenesch reads her story “Enough for Now,” from the April 6, 2026, issue of the magazine. Neyenesch is a Brooklyn-based writer and curator, who has published nonfiction in the Guardian, Public Books, and Art in America, among other places.
